Amen! Interesting to note that the operators of 'world class' contest
stations never appear to suffer from sore throats caused by shouting during
a contest period, while some other folk end up 'croaking'.
My Heil ProSet Plus headset allows my rigs to be driven to full output
without shouting, including an unmodified K2/100 #3255 without an external
audio preamp, and is comfortable to wear for long periods. The combination
of the HC5 mic element and 2.1 kHz transmitter filters breaks pile-ups
without having to use the HC4 mic element, at the same time receives
complimentary reports on audio quality. External acoustic noise has never
been a problem here.
